INTERPRETIVE THEMES

As our organization plans to revisit and revise our Interpretive Themes, we are planning a series of lunchtime seminars on the themes developed for recent Interpretive Plans in our area.

In the first seminar, Darian Beverungen, Cultural Resources Planner in the Planning and Zoning Department in Anne Arundel County, will present the County’s Interpretive Framework as presented in the document, “White Paper: Assessment of Anne Arundel County’s Existing Historic Preservation Program.” The presentation will be virtual, via Zoom, on Tuesday, October 25, at Noon, and a Q-and-A session will follow the presentation.
